Firefighters are racing to tackle a wildfire that broke out on the eastern Aegean island of Chios as Greece’s prime minister warns of a dangerous summer ahead.

Two large wildfires were burning Sunday near Greece's capital of Athens, and authorities sent emergency messages for some residents to evacuate and others to stay at home and close their windows to protect themselves from smoke.

Emergency services issued evacuation orders for those in the Metohi area of western Chios, urging them to head to a nearby beach. Mitsotakis said the use of drones as part of an early warning system for wildfires had been particularly useful this year and credited better coordination between authorities and volunteer firefighters for limiting the extent of fire damage so far. “We are entering the tough core of the anti-fire period, and this will certainly not be won without the help of the public as well, particularly in the field of prevention,” Mitsotakis said.last month.
